When it comes to Halloween costumes, some of them are good, some of them are bad, and some of them are utterly inspired. We all want to stand out from the crowd on this holiday when dressing up as something is acceptable.

But this year, it's looking as though we've all already been outdone by a tiny baby, who has the best Halloween costume ever. Yes, this week an 8-month-old boy from North Carolina has gone viral on social media; all because of the awesome costume his mom designed, based on the hit sitcom The Office.

Jillian Sheffield took to Instagram this week, to share a picture of her newborn son Jackwell. However, Jackwell wasn't exactly wearing the attire you'd expect from a boy his age. He was instead dressed in a short-sleeved yellow shirt, a tie, shorts, pants, and glasses, and with his hair styled into a centre-parting.

That's right! Jackwell was actually dressed as the character of Dwight Schrute, played by Rainn Wilson, and to be honest, the resemblance was uncanny. Jillian even captioned the post with a quote from Dwight himself, writing: "'All you need is love. false. the four basic human necessities are air, water, food, and shelter. [sic]'"

The picture managed to accrue over 1,000 likes in a few days on Instagram, and achieved even more likes, shares, and comments after Barstool Sports shared the picture on its Instagram page.

Jillian hasn't confirmed whether or not her little boy will be wearing this ensemble on October 31st, but she did tell a Los Angeles Fox affiliate that she and her spouse play dress Jackwell up in colourful costumes. Indeed, a cursory glance at his mother's Instagram shows that he's already been dressed as a lumberjack once before.
